RestoreX360 Premium is a comprehensive Windows system recovery and optimization software developed by UQuick Technologies India Limited. Designed for personal use, it allows users to create real-time system snapshots and restore their PC to a previous stable state in seconds – even if Windows fails to boot.

Unlike traditional tools, RestoreX360 works at the BIOS level using a pre-boot recovery console, enabling access to system snapshots before Windows starts. This makes it especially useful for fixing boot errors like Blue Screen of Death (BSOD), black screens, update failures, or system crashes caused by malware or driver conflicts.

Product Limitations

The following limitations still exist in the latest RestoreX360:

– Booting From an External Media (OS): RestoreX360 cannot protect a hard drive when changes are made to the hard drive from an external or foreign (Windows or non-Windows) operating system bypassing RestoreX360 device drivers. For example, booting from a CD-ROM based Windows PE will start a different OS before RestoreX360 driver is loaded, that could change the hard drive data without acknowledging the existence of RestoreX360 snapshots on the hard drive and produce unpredictable results.

–  Disk Encryption Programs that Intercept Low-Level Disk I/O: RestoreX360 may have conflict with some applications that proxy low-level disk I/O.

–  Dual Boot of Windows and Linux OS on the Same Hard Drive: RestoreX360 does not support systems that have multiple Windows Operating Systems with non-Windows Operating System (like Linux) loaded on the same hard drive.

Let’s explain it with an example:

You are managing a network of 30 PCs. You have a file server.

1. You install and protect the 30 PCs with RestoreX360 Pro.

2. You install the RestoreX360 Endpoint Manager Server Service on the file server.

3. Install the RestoreX360 Endpoint Manager Console on your desktop or laptop.

4. You connect the RestoreX360 Pro clients to the Endpoint Manager Server Service on the file server.

5. You open the Endpoint Manager Console on your desktop and connect it to the Server Service on the file server. You can remotely manage all the RestoreX360 Pro clients.

RestoreX360 Endpoint Manager has two parts: the Endpoint Manager Server Service and the Endpoint Manager Console. The Server Service keeps client workstation connections running. The console gives you a graphical user interface.

For example:

You install the server service on a company server that is always on.

You install the console on your desktop PC. You open the console on your desktop and connect to the server service. This lets you view and manage client workstations linked to the Endpoint Manager Server Service.

If you can’t connect RestoreX360 Pro clients to an endpoint manager, follow these steps to solve the problem:

1. Ensure you can ping the computer with the Endpoint Manager from the client workstation. Also, ping the client workstation from the Endpoint Manager computer. The ping must work in both directions.

2. Ensure Port 9000 is open on the client and Endpoint Manager computers.

3. If you cannot connect the RestoreX360 Pro client to the Endpoint Manager, please check the steps above. If it still does not work, send the following log files to UQuick Technologies Support.

Log file from Endpoint Manager:

To access RestoreX360 Endpoint console logs from the file menu, select File->Logs.

Save the log file as a text file.

Log file from RestoreX360 Pro client:

a. Open the RestoreX360 application console and select Event logs.

b. Save the logs as a text file.
